




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
2025年MySQL測試與調試技能試題及答案姓名:____________________
一、單項選擇題(每題2分,共10題)
1.MySQL是一種什么類型的數據庫管理系統(tǒng)?
A.關系型數據庫管理系統(tǒng)
B.文件型數據庫管理系統(tǒng)
C.對象型數據庫管理系統(tǒng)
D.面向對象數據庫管理系統(tǒng)
2.以下哪個是MySQL中用于創(chuàng)建數據庫的語句?
A.CREATETABLE
B.CREATEINDEX
C.CREATEDATABASE
D.CREATEVIEW
3.在MySQL中,以下哪個命令用于查看數據庫中的所有表?
A.SELECT*FROMTABLE
B.DESCRIBETABLE
C.SHOWTABLES
D.SELECT*FROMDATABASE
4.以下哪個是MySQL中用于刪除數據庫的語句?
A.DROPTABLE
B.DROPDATABASE
C.DELETEFROMTABLE
D.TRUNCATETABLE
5.在MySQL中,以下哪個是用于創(chuàng)建索引的語句?
A.CREATEINDEX
B.ADDINDEX
C.INDEX
D.INDEXED
6.以下哪個是MySQL中用于更新表中數據的語句?
A.INSERTINTO
B.UPDATETABLE
C.REPLACEINTO
D.DELETEFROM
7.在MySQL中,以下哪個是用于刪除表中數據的語句?
A.DELETEFROM
B.DROPTABLE
C.TRUNCATETABLE
D.REPLACEINTO
8.以下哪個是MySQL中用于選擇查詢的語句?
A.SELECT
B.FROM
C.WHERE
D.ORDERBY
9.在MySQL中,以下哪個是用于排序查詢結果的語句?
A.ASC
B.DESC
C.ORDERBY
D.GROUPBY
10.以下哪個是MySQL中用于分組查詢的語句?
A.SELECT
B.FROM
C.WHERE
D.GROUPBY
二、多項選擇題(每題3分,共10題)
1.MySQL支持以下哪些數據類型?
A.整數類型
B.浮點數類型
C.字符串類型
D.日期和時間類型
E.二進制數據類型
2.在MySQL中,以下哪些是常用的字符集?
A.utf8
B.ascii
C.utf8mb4
D.cp1251
E.big5
3.以下哪些是MySQL中用于設置字符集的語句?
A.SETNAMES
B.SETCHARACTERSET
C.SETCOLLATION
D.SETCHARSET
E.ALTERDATABASE
4.在MySQL中,以下哪些是用于備份和還原數據庫的方法?
A.導出SQL文件
B.導入SQL文件
C.備份工具
D.復制數據庫文件
E.使用命令行工具
5.以下哪些是MySQL中用于管理用戶的命令?
A.GRANT
B.REVOKE
C.CREATEUSER
D.DROPUSER
E.RENAMEUSER
6.在MySQL中,以下哪些是用于設置權限的命令?
A.ALLPRIVILEGES
B.SELECT
C.INSERT
D.UPDATE
E.DELETE
7.以下哪些是MySQL中用于查看當前會話信息的命令?
A.SHOWPROCESSLIST
B.SHOWSESSION
C.SELECT*FROMinformation_cesslist
D.SELECT*FROMmysql.session
E.SELECT*FROMinformation_schema.tables
8.在MySQL中,以下哪些是用于處理事務的命令?
A.STARTTRANSACTION
B.COMMIT
C.ROLLBACK
D.SAVEPOINT
E.SETTRANSACTION
9.以下哪些是MySQL中用于處理錯誤和異常的命令?
A.DECLARE
B.SIGNAL
C.HANDLER
D.DECLARECONTINUEHANDLER
E.DECLAREEXITHANDLER
10.在MySQL中,以下哪些是用于存儲過程和函數的命令?
A.CREATEPROCEDURE
B.CREATEFUNCTION
C.CALL
D.RETURN
E.PROCEDURE
三、判斷題(每題2分,共10題)
1.在MySQL中,默認的字符集是utf8。()
2.使用ALTERTABLE語句可以修改已經創(chuàng)建的表的字段名和數據類型。()
3.在MySQL中,所有字段都可以設置默認值。()
4.MySQL中的索引可以提高查詢效率,但也會增加插入、刪除和更新操作的開銷。()
5.在MySQL中,外鍵約束可以保證數據的一致性和完整性。()
6.使用SHOWINDEX語句可以查看一個表的所有索引信息。()
7.MySQL中的事務可以保證一系列操作要么全部成功,要么全部失敗。()
8.在MySQL中,可以使用TRIGGER來定義在數據變動時自動執(zhí)行的操作。()
9.MySQL中的存儲過程只能包含SQL語句,不能包含控制流語句。()
10.在MySQL中,視圖是一個虛擬的表,它不實際存儲數據,只存儲查詢結果。()
四、簡答題(每題5分,共6題)
1.簡述MySQL中事務的特性。
2.如何在MySQL中創(chuàng)建一個索引,并解釋其作用。
3.描述如何在MySQL中創(chuàng)建一個存儲過程,并給出一個簡單的例子。
4.解釋什么是視圖,并說明其與表的關聯(lián)。
5.如何在MySQL中設置用戶權限,包括授予和回收權限。
6.簡述MySQL中備份和還原數據庫的基本步驟。
試卷答案如下
一、單項選擇題(每題2分,共10題)
1.A
解析思路:MySQL是一種關系型數據庫管理系統(tǒng),它使用SQL(結構化查詢語言)進行數據的查詢和管理。
2.C
解析思路:CREATEDATABASE語句用于創(chuàng)建新的數據庫。
3.C
解析思路:SHOWTABLES語句用于顯示當前數據庫中的所有表。
4.B
解析思路:DROPDATABASE語句用于刪除數據庫。
5.A
解析思路:CREATEINDEX語句用于創(chuàng)建索引。
6.B
解析思路:UPDATETABLE語句用于更新表中數據。
7.A
解析思路:DELETEFROM語句用于刪除表中數據。
8.A
解析思路:SELECT語句用于選擇查詢,從數據庫中檢索數據。
9.C
解析思路:ORDERBY語句用于對查詢結果進行排序。
10.D
解析思路:GROUPBY語句用于分組查詢,根據某個字段對結果進行分組。
二、多項選擇題(每題3分,共10題)
1.ABCDE
解析思路:MySQL支持多種數據類型,包括整數、浮點數、字符串、日期和時間以及二進制數據。
2.ABCDE
解析思路:utf8、ascii、utf8mb4、cp1251和big5都是MySQL中常用的字符集。
3.ABCD
解析思路:SETNAMES、SETCHARACTERSET、SETCOLLATION和SETCHARSET都是用于設置字符集的語句。
4.ABCDE
解析思路:導出SQL文件、導入SQL文件、備份工具、復制數據庫文件和使用命令行工具都是MySQL中用于備份和還原數據庫的方法。
5.ABCDE
解析思路:GRANT、REVOKE、CREATEUSER、DROPUSER和RENAMEUSER都是用于管理用戶的命令。
6.ABCDE
解析思路:ALLPRIVILEGES、SELECT、INSERT、UPDATE和DELETE都是用于設置權限的命令。
7.ABCDE
解析思路:SHOWPROCESSLIST、SHOWSESSION、SELECT*FROMinformation_cesslist、SELECT*FROMmysql.session和SELECT*FROMinformation_schema.tables都是用于查看會話信息的命令。
8.ABCDE
解析思路:STARTTRANSACTION、COMMIT、ROLLBACK、SAVEPOINT和SETTRANSACTION都是用于處理事務的命令。
9.ABCDE
解析思路:DECLARE、SIGNAL、HANDLER、DECLARECONTINUEHANDLER和DECLAREEXITHANDLER都是用于處理錯誤和異常的命令。
10.ABCDE
解析思路:CREATEPROCEDURE、CREATEFUNCTION、CALL、RETURN和PROCEDURE都是用于存儲過程和函數的命令。
三、判斷題(每題2分,共10題)
1.×
解析思路:默認的字符集通常是latin1,而不是utf8。
2.√
解析思路:ALTERTABLE語句可以修改表的字段名和數據類型。
3.×
解析思路:并非所有字段都可以設置默認值,例如,對于自動增長的整數類型字段,通常不能設置默認值。
4.√
解析思路:索引可以提高查詢效率,但也可能增加數據修改操作的開銷。
5.√
解析思路:外鍵約束確保了數據的一致性和完整性,通過引用另一個表的主鍵來定義。
6.√
解析思路:SHOWINDEX語句可以顯
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 水域養(yǎng)殖合同協(xié)議書模板
- 公司入股投資合同協(xié)議書
- 主播合同終止協(xié)議書
- 綠化養(yǎng)護合同協(xié)議書范本
- 單位團建合同協(xié)議書模板
- 學校糧油供貨合同協(xié)議書
- 球館轉讓合同協(xié)議書怎么寫
- 小紅書達人品牌合作與內容營銷協(xié)議
- 花地轉讓合同協(xié)議書
- 環(huán)保項目施工監(jiān)理補充協(xié)議
- GA 38-2021銀行安全防范要求
- 消防安全主題班會課件(共17張ppt)
- 《全球通史》課件
- 北師版六年級解方程練習200題
- 外貿鎖檢測報告樣式EN12209
- 無損檢測人員登記表
- DB33-T 2048-2017(2021)民宿基本要求與評價
- 1員工培訓記錄表表格類
- 某大學論文答辯模板課件
- 50以內加減法練習題打印版(100題)
- 基礎體溫表格基礎體溫表
評論
0/150
提交評論